Analysis of Players and Strategies
Both teams have formidable rosters filled with young talents and seasoned veterans. For the Wild, their defensive strategy has been highlighted through the performances of defenseman Jonas Brodin, who excels at shutting down opposing forwards. The team’s goalkeeping, led by Marc-André Fleury, has been a pivotal factor in their recent successes.
The Canucks, on the other hand, aim to leverage their speed. With players like J.T. Miller and Brock Boeser, they have the capability to turn the tide of any game in a matter of minutes. Their strategy focuses on quick transitions and puck control, often creating a high-paced offense that challenges even the toughest defenses.
